Just How Can Human Resources Leaders Take Care Of Top Seasonal Overtime Prices?



Managing seasonal labor expenditures requires real-time data tracking and strict cross-departmental interaction between managers and payroll professionals. Department heads control budgets effectively by establishing clear pre-approval methods for any hours prolonging past common shifts. Utilizing advanced digital scheduling systems permits supervisors to receive instant notifications when a staff member comes close to the weekly threshold. This exposure allows aggressive adjustments, such as shifting tasks to qualified team members who have not yet reached costs pay standing.



Cross-training your existing labor force gives a scalable remedy that lowers the dependence on extensive changes during top operational needs. When numerous workers possess the skills to handle customized jobs, scheduling flexibility raises significantly. This tactical approach maintains general labor costs foreseeable while all at once minimizing employee fatigue during warm summer season. Reviewing your once a week labor analytics assists recognize which departments consistently surpass their targets, allowing for targeted intervention.
